Transaction 70a15f8a2143e3abe3111c60c4bf27fe1be794beea21a809160db1e2ffdfbe0b

21 Input
2 Outputs
  • 70a15f8a2143e3abe3111c60c4bf27fe1be794beea21a809160db1e2ffdfbe0b:0
  • value  9983352
    address  13coHEogHH7qfSyr5ZcTkUoim2XZu4Af1G
  • 70a15f8a2143e3abe3111c60c4bf27fe1be794beea21a809160db1e2ffdfbe0b:1
  • value  1003426
    address  12gkTFKzGrcxZH92Wy6pZG8BoxuyuWnQwC